Drum Brake Shoe & Lining Replacement: Removal

  1. Release parking brake and loosen parking brake cable at equalizer. If necessary, back off brake adjustment before removing brake drums. Remove return springs. Remove brake shoe hold down springs and cups. Lift up on parking brake actuator lever and remove actuator link. Remove actuator lever and return spring.
  2. Separate brake shoes from wheel cylinder connecting links. Remove parking brake strut and spring. Disconnect parking brake cable. Remove brake shoes, spring and adjusting screw from backing plate. Detach spring and screw from brake shoes. Remove parking brake lever from secondary shoe.
